Output 659b1b68695d5ad656e84fdfc13018ad3dab1959b1affac941234db1a2e0491d:0

value
6942006736152
script pubkey
OP_0 OP_PUSHBYTES_20 2eb86af1ddf0f76167e313466b34e3159c4b4549
address
tb1q96ux4uwa7rmkzelrzdrxkd8rzkwyk32fputjfk
transaction
659b1b68695d5ad656e84fdfc13018ad3dab1959b1affac941234db1a2e0491d
confirmations
187484
spent
true